Elements to Consider When Buying a Couch
When acquiring a couch, several aspects ought to be taken into consideration to make sure the best choice for individual requirements. Here's a list of vital factors to consider:

Size and Layout: Measure your space to guarantee the couch fits comfortably without overcrowding the space. Consider the design and flow of the area.

Comfort Level: Test the couch by resting on it to assess assistance, softness, and overall comfort.

Durability: Look for premium materials and building and construction. Consider how often the couch will be utilized and by whom (e.g., kids, pets).

Style Compatibility: Ensure the couch design matches the room's general design and visual.

Budget: Determine a budget before shopping and try to find choices within that range to prevent overspending.

Performance: Consider if you need additional functions like recliners or pull-out beds based upon your lifestyle.
4. Couch Maintenance Tips
Keeping a couch in great condition requires regular maintenance. Here are some suggestions for lengthening the life of a couch:

Regular Cleaning: Vacuum the couch frequently to get rid of dust and debris. For fabric couches, think about expert cleansing every couple of years.

Safeguard from Sunlight: Position the couch away from direct sunlight to prevent fading and damage with time.

Use Coasters: If using the couch for treats or drinks, consider using coasters to avoid spots.

Rotate Cushions: If your couch has removable cushions, turn them frequently to ensure even wear.

Use Fabric Protectors: Use material protectors suitable for your couch material to boost stain resistance.
5.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: What size couch need to I purchase for a little apartment?A: For small areas, consider a loveseat or a compact sectional. Measure the location and choose a couch that allows for comfortable movement around the room.

Q: How do I choose a color for my couch?A: Consider the existing design and color design of your home. Neutral colors can be versatile, while bold colors can act as a declaration piece. Q: Can I personalize my couch?A: Many sellers offer personalization choices, including material option, color, dimensions, and additional functions. Consult the seller for custom options. Q: Are leather couches worth the investment?A: While leather Couches For sale Near me can be more expensive upfront, they usually provide sturdiness and ease of upkeep, potentially conserving money in the long run. Q: How long ought to an excellent couch last?A: With appropriate care, a high-quality couch can last anywhere from 7 to 15 years or longer. Factors like use and material quality can affect longevity.
